PDA

Показать полную графическую версию : [addon] Tweaks (Твики реестра для всех учётных записей)


Страниц : 1 2 [3] 4

SOLON7
07-11-2010, 18:17
Akella130986, можно сделать конфигуратор этих твиков.
Я могу обьяснить как это сделать !!

Можно сделать формат такой.
;;------------------------------
; Не отслеживать время последнего обращения к файлам и папкам
[H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\FileSystem]
"NtfsDisableLastAccessUpdate"=dword:00000001
;;------------------------------
; CHKDSK при загрузке Windows таймаут 5 сек
[H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Session Manager]
"AutoChkTimeOut"=dword:00000005


Программа сама будет определять начало и конец твика а потом от выбора твика пользователем будет формировать АДДОН.

Akella130986, если вы и дальше будете поддерживать проект, то я могу для вас оболочку конфигуратор сделать !!!

Nun-Nun
08-11-2010, 10:50
Подскажите, можно ли сделать так, чтобы хрюша не отслеживала историю запускавшихся документов, за исключением программ MS Office, ибо в офисе сия функция весьма полезна? Использовал вот этот твик, но похоже, он выключает слежку вообще во всех программах:

; Не записывать историю открывавшихся документов
[H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Policies\Explorer]
"NoRecentDocsHistory"=dword:00000001

SOLON7
08-11-2010, 12:38
но похоже, он выключает слежку вообще во всех программах: »
Этот твик для этого и создан. Он напрочь вырубает фунцию RecentDocs в системе!!

Nun-Nun
08-11-2010, 14:08
SOLON7,

Как-то не гибко. Создателям стОило бы подумать о вариантах.

SOLON7
08-11-2010, 17:04
Как-то не гибко. Создателям стОило бы подумать о вариантах. »
Все вопросы к Microsoft Corporation !!

Nun-Nun
09-11-2010, 13:14
Все вопросы к Microsoft Corporation !! »
Ну разумеется, о Microsoft-е и речь!

vovansa
09-11-2010, 17:33
Akella130986, никуда от них не денешься )).
Да и количество постов как они будут набивать, как не дурацкими вопросами ))
Не отстреливать же их на подходе к форуму )))))

langolier2001
06-12-2010, 18:29
К сожалению, аддон не совсем универсален: подходит только для "одиночного" дистрибутива, т.е. где WIN51 лежит в корне.
На мультизагрузочных системах, например в MultiBoot USB v2.4 (http://forum.oszone.net/thread-149975.html) "WIN51" лежит в ":\WINSETUP\XPpSP3\", аддон естественно работать не будет. Конечно, можно в данном случае переписать tweaks.cmd, но тогда для каждого случая придется пересобирать образ. Так что, придется вернуться к схеме копирования через $OEM$, а жаль.

timon45
29-12-2010, 18:04
langolier2001 полезное замечание, а ведь действительно это так. Хорошо если автор напишет решение данного недочета в первом посте.

langolier2001
08-01-2011, 14:08
Мне бы хотелось, что бы один раз собранный дистрибутив работал и с CD-R и с мультизагрузочной флэшки... ;)

Я вот тут подумал, а почему бы не взять путь установки из реестра, но ничего из этой затеи не вышло.
Но на msfn прочитал: один из участников предложит использовать "$WINNT$.INF", уверяя, что это работает уже аж на T-39. Попробовал установку с MultiBoot USB v2.4 и всё получилось. Предполагаю, что и при установки с CD всё будет так же хорошо.
Вот такой вариант "tweaks.cmd" я использовал:

@ECHO OFF

FOR /F "skip=2 usebackq" %%d IN (`FIND "dospath" %SystemRoot%\SYSTEM32\$WINNT$.INF`) DO SET %%d
SET CDROM=%dospath%

REGEDIT /s "%CDROM%I386\SVCPACK\hkcu.reg"

COPY "%CDROM%I386\SVCPACK\hklm.reg" "%WINDIR%\hklm.reg"
REG ADD HKLM\Software\Microsoft\Windows\CurrentVersion\RunOnce /V Tweaks_1 /D "REGEDIT /S %WINDIR%\hklm.reg"
REG ADD HKLM\Software\Microsoft\Windows\CurrentVersion\RunOnce /V Tweaks_2 /D "CMD /C DEL /Q /F %WINDIR%\hklm.reg"

EXIT

Преимущества: путь дистрибутива, с которого устанавливается система, указывается "точно", и не надо искать его по всем дискам. :)

Источник: http://www.msfn.org/board/topic/22386-a-mega-easy-to-get-the-cdrom-variable-set/page__st__20__p__162528#entry162528

LIM
07-02-2011, 22:00
Akella130986,
Можно организовать отдельно секцию SERVICES.REG для записи только служб, с отработкой после выполнения HKCU.REG и HKLM.REG

LIM
11-02-2011, 00:15
Akella130986, легче контролировать внесенные изменения. Всегда работаю с тремя файлами HKCU.REG и HKLM.REG и SERVICES.REG.

vitbomba
11-02-2011, 01:12
LIM, возможно так и правда лучше, хотя можна и так дописать как для IE и WMP чтобы не путаться.

leeseecin
13-02-2011, 13:49
LIM, vitbomba,
NB все нижеследущее - бред автора, все команды вымышлены, исполнение кода - случайно, никаких гарантий... :)
и так, файл.reg настроек запуска служб уже есть. создаем новый или правим имеющийся файл.cmd. определяемся с обработкой файла. для запуска на t-13 пишим

REGEDIT /s "%CDROM%\I386\SVCPACK\файл.reg"

если хотим через runonce, тогда определяемся с местом запуска (hdd или CD/DVD). если с CD/DVD, то добавляем в реестр ключ

REG ADD HKLM\Software\Microsoft\Windows\CurrentVersion\RunOnce /V имя_параметра /D "REGEDIT /S %CDROM%\I386\SVCPACK\файл.reg

если с hdd, то сначала копируем на диск

COPY "%CDROM%\I386\SVCPACK\файл.reg" "путь\"

после, добавляем ключ запуска

REG ADD HKLM\Software\Microsoft\Windows\CurrentVersion\RunOnce /V имя_параметра /D "REGEDIT /S путь\файл.reg"

осталось удалить с hdd, если нужно. или через runonce

REG ADD HKLM\Software\Microsoft\Windows\CurrentVersion\RunOnce /V другое_имя_параметра /D "CMD /C DEL /Q /F путь\файл.reg"

или любым др. способом. все - выход (exit)

PS если создали свой файл.cmd, не забываем о назначении перемнной CDROM и правке\создании файла run. как вариант, можно разнести твики реестра\служб для IE, WMP, nVidia, Acronis, Office...
PPS это у вас НИКОГДА не сработает... (если не использовать) :)

vitbomba
16-02-2011, 21:51
Liveride, отлично. Спасибо.

momo2000
21-02-2011, 13:25
Akella130986, зря Вы так, такой ответ тоже особого ума Вам не придаёт

d petr
21-02-2011, 13:52
Liveride, в вашем варианте аддона прописаны переменные TEMP и TMP на диск C:, а если он под другой буквой? К примеру много вопросов возникнет когда кардридер пропишет себе буквы с C: по G: а системным будет H. Предлагаю либо удалить соответствующие строки, либо заменить их значения в файле HKLM.REG на "TEMP"="%SystemDrive%\\Temp" и "TMP"="%SystemDrive%\\Temp" и добавить команду MD %SystemDrive%\Temp в TWEAKS.CMD

zeroua
21-02-2011, 14:19
Liveride, Akella130986, Рекомендую прекратить перепалку, как в открытом виде так и в ПМ, то что вы будете поливать друг друга грязью и оскорблениями не поможет вам в создании данного аддона и его улучшении. Только в здоровом и грамотном споре может родится истина, а в этом может родится лишь никому ненужная агрессия.

zeroua
21-02-2011, 14:45
Akella130986, для особо придирчивых можно внести, это способ внесения твиков, а не набор твиков », данную информацию в шапку темы.

З.Ы. оптимальное решение проблем и внесение предложений удобнее делать не в ПМ, а тут. Одна голова хорошо, две лучше, а целый форум :) просто отлично.

adyg_94
21-02-2011, 17:40
Ну там все по человечески написано!!! Что не понятно там написано???




© OSzone.net 2001-2012